Openstack CI log processing
===========================
The goal of this repository is to provide and check
functionality of new log processing system base on
zuul log scraper tool.
Zuul Log Scraper
----------------
The Zuul Log Scraper tool is responsible for periodical
check by using Zuul CI API if there are new builds available
and if there are some, it would push the informations to
the log processing system.
Testing
-------
The part of Openstack CI log processing runs a complete testing and
continuous-integration environment, powered by `Zuul
<https://zuul-ci.org/>`__.
Any changes to logscraper script or tests will trigger jobs to
thoroughly test those changes.
Continuous Deployment
---------------------
Once changes are reviewed and committed, they will be applied
automatically to the production hosts.

Logscraper
==========
The logscraper tool can be running as a one-shot log scrape or
as periodical check, if some new log jobs are available.
The tool have help function, that is showing available options for it.
It is available by typing:
.. code-block::
logscraper --help
Basic usage
-----------
Base on the use case, we can run logscraper.
Example:
* periodical check if there are some new logs for `openstack` tenant:
.. code-block::
logscraper --gearman-server somehost --zuul-api-url https://zuul.opendev.org/api/tenant/openstack --checkpoint-file /tmp/results-checkpoint.txt --follow
* one shot on getting logs from `zuul` tenant:
.. code-block::
logscraper --gearman-server localhost --zuul-api-url https://zuul.opendev.org/api/tenant/zuul --checkpoint-file /tmp/zuul-result-timestamp.txt
* periodically scrape logs from tenants: `openstack`, `zuul` and `local`
.. code-block::
logscraper --gearman-server localhost --zuul-api-url https://zuul.opendev.org/api/tenant/openstack --zuul-api-url https://zuul.opendev.org/api/tenant/zuul --zuul-api-url https://zuul.opendev.org/api/tenant/local --checkpoint-file /tmp/someresults.txt --follow
Containerize tool
-----------------
Instead of using `pip` tool, you can build your own container image
that contains logscraper tool, for example:
.. code-block::
docker build -t logscraper -f Dockerfile
Then you can execute commands that are described above.
NOTE: if you want to use parameter `--checkpoint-file`, you need to mount a volume
to the container, for example:
.. code-block::
docker run -v $(pwd):/checkpoint-dir:z -d logscraper logscraper --gearman-server somehost --zuul-api-url https://zuul.opendev.org/api/tenant/openstack --checkpoint-file /checkpoint-dir/checkpoint.txt --follow

def parse_version(zuul_version_txt):
"""Parse the zuul version returned by the different services:
>>> parse_version("4.6.0-1.el7")
StrictVersion ('4.6')
>>> parse_version("4.10.2.dev6 22f04be1")
StrictVersion ('4.10.2')
>>> parse_version("4.10.2.dev6 22f04be1") > parse_version("4.6.0-1.el7")
True
>>> parse_version("4.6.0-1.el7") > parse_version("4.7.0")
False
"""
if not zuul_version_txt:
return
zuul_version = zuul_version_txt
# drop rpm package suffix
zuul_version = zuul_version.split("-")[0]
# drop pip package suffix
zuul_version = zuul_version.split(".dev")[0]
try:
return s_version(zuul_version)
except Exception:
raise ValueError("Invalid zuul version: %s" % zuul_version_txt)
def _zuul_complete_available(zuul_url, insecure):
"""Return additional parameter for zuul url
When Zuul version is newer that 4.7.0, return additional
parameter.
"""
url = zuul_url + "/status"
zuul_status = requests.get(url, verify=insecure)
zuul_status.raise_for_status()
zuul_version = parse_version(zuul_status.json().get("zuul_version"))
if zuul_version and zuul_version >= s_version("4.7.0"):
return "&complete=true"
def get_builds(zuul_url, insecure):
"""Yield builds dictionary."""
pos, size = 0, 100
zuul_url = zuul_url.rstrip("/")
zuul_complete = _zuul_complete_available(zuul_url, insecure)
if zuul_complete:
extra = "" + zuul_complete
base_url = zuul_url + "/builds?limit=" + str(size) + extra
known_builds = set()
while True:
url = base_url + "&skip=" + str(pos)
logging.info("Getting job results %s", url)
jobs_result = requests.get(url, verify=insecure)
jobs_result.raise_for_status()
for job in jobs_result.json():
# It is important here to check we didn't yield builds twice,
# as this can happen when using skip if new build get reported
# between the two requests.
if job["uuid"] not in known_builds:
yield job
known_builds.add(job["uuid"])
pos += 1
def get_last_job_results(zuul_url, insecure, max_skipped, last_uuid):
"""Yield builds until we find the last uuid."""
count = 0
for build in get_builds(zuul_url, insecure):
if count > max_skipped:
break
if build["uuid"] == last_uuid:
break
yield build
count += 1
